First Step: Read your audition details

Please read your audition details carefully, as they sometimes specify the type of song they'd like to hear (a ballad, something uptempo, etc.). Make sure to select a song that's appropriate for your specific casting call. Also, as you're picking out a song, these links may be helpful:
